"BioMetal," released for the Super Nintendo Entertainment System (SNES) in 1993, is a horizontally scrolling shoot 'em up game developed by Athena and published by Activision. Set in a futuristic sci-fi universe, the game offers players fast-paced action, intense shooting mechanics, and a variety of power-ups.

The game's plot unfolds in GC 232 (Galaxy Century Year 232), a time when an ongoing interstellar war has devastated the Milky Way, depleting its natural resources. The Galactic Council dispatches a starship fleet to the nearby planet UP457 in search of resources. However, the fleet is obliterated by the "BIOMETAL," a race of hybrid creatures. A supercomputer predicts the rapid expansion of the "BIOMETALS" and the imminent takeover of the Milky Way within 32 hours. Kid Ray and biologist Anita, crew members of the Halbard, alongside the fleet WASP, are tasked with quelling the hostile threat on UP457.

Gameplay involves obtaining weapon power-ups by destroying pods and collecting released items. These power-ups cycle through various weapon types and can negate each other. A shield, represented by spinning orbs, offers defense against enemy fire. Engaging the shield drains charge power. As players navigate the high-speed action of "BioMetal," they must strategize, adapt to different weaponry, and save the Milky Way from impending doom.

The game features six challenging levels, each with its own unique design and enemies. Unique to the European and North American versions of "BioMetal" is a soundtrack featuring remixed tracks from the techno group 2 Unlimited's 1991 album, "Get Ready!" Conversely, the Japanese release features an entirely different musical composition.
